site stats

Tokio receiver 并发

Webb吴翱翔: 假设 hyper http 处理一个 http (rpc) 请求要 15 秒,handler 函数内 tokio::spawn,此时如果请求没处理完 客户端主动断开链接,hyper 会 cancel propagation 将 HTTP … Webb19 sep. 2024 · Tokio的任务非常轻,只需要一个64字节的上下文即可,考虑到Rust中也没有GC机制,因此基于Tokio理论上完全可以做出比Golang支持更多并发的应用程序,这也 …

Tokio Tutorial - 4. Channel - 知乎

Webb2 aug. 2024 · MongoDB异地容灾多活 2024.5.21 郑涔(明俨) 为了无法计算的价值为了无法计算的价值 Agenda 有关异地容灾多活 MongoDB异地容灾多活可能的几个方案 MongoDB实例间同步通道Lamda系统的设计和实现 为了无法计算的价值为了无法计算的价值 为什么要异地容灾多活 容灾的 ... WebbChecks if this channel contains a message that this receiver has not yet seen. The new value is not marked as seen. Although this method is called has_changed , it does not check new messages for equality, so this call will return true even if the new message is equal to the old message. henry\u0027s old shape https://topratedinvestigations.com

郑涔- MongoDB异地容灾多活.pdf 25页 - 原创力文档

Webb10 nov. 2024 · 2.1.1 Sender-receiver. Sender/Receiver通道是最多见的通道配置方式,Sender做为通道的发送方也是通道链接的主动发起方,Receiver做为通道的接收方也是通道链接的被动监听方。 在下面配置脚本中,通道链接两个队列管理器QM1和QM2。其中,QM1为Sender方,QM2为Receiver方。 WebbReceives the next value for this receiver. Each Receiver handle will receive a clone of all values sent after it has subscribed.. Err(RecvError::Closed) is returned when all Sender halves have dropped, indicating that no further values can be sent on the channel. If the Receiver handle falls behind, once the channel is full, newly sent values will overwrite old … Webb5 feb. 2024 · 所以在KafkaUtils.createStream()方法中,增加特定topic的分区数只能够增加单个receiver消费这个 topic的线程数,不能增加Spark处理数据的并发数。 通过不同的group和topic,可以创建多个输入DStream,从而利用多个 receiver 并发的接收数据。 henry\u0027s on

rust - 如何查找tokio::sync::mpsc::Receiver是否已关闭? - IT工具网

Category:rust - 如何查找tokio::sync::mpsc::Receiver是否已关闭? - IT工具网

Tags:Tokio receiver 并发

Tokio receiver 并发

Tokio教程概况 Tokio学习笔记

Webb哪里可以找行业研究报告?三个皮匠报告网的最新栏目每日会更新大量报告,包括行业研究报告、市场调研报告、行业分析报告、外文报告、会议报告、招股书、白皮书、世界500强企业分析报告以及券商报告等内容的更新,通过最新栏目,大家可以快速找到自己想要的内 … Webbuse tokio::sync::oneshot; // 1.0.2 fn main() { let (sender, receiver) = oneshot::channel::(); tokio::spawn(async move { sender.send(3).unwrap(); loop { // …

Tokio receiver 并发

Did you know?

http://www.javashuo.com/article/p-gpmztojz-ka.html Webb13.3 - 迭代器(中 - 迭代器适配器) Iterator 特型可以为迭代器提供大量可供选择的适配器方法,或简称适配器(adapter)。; 适配器消费一个迭代器,并创建一个具备有用行为的新迭代器。 13.3.1-map 和 filtermap 适配器:为迭代器的每个迭代项都应用一个闭包。. filter 适配器:通过迭代器来过滤某些迭代 ...

Webb1 juli 2015 · 的协程和通道理所当然的支持确定性的并发方式(例如通道具有一个 sender 和一个 receiver)。 并发和并行的差异 Go 的并发原语提供了良好的并发设计基础:表达程序结构以便表示独立地执行的动作;所以Go的的重点不在于并行的首要位置:并发程序可能是并行的,也可能不是。 Webb每个任务的并发. tokio::spawn 与 select! 都可以运行并发异步操作。但是用于运行并发操作的策略有所不同。tokio::spawn 函数传入一个异步操作并产生一个 新的任务去运行它。任务是一个tokio运行时调度的对象。

WebbThis is supported on feature="sync" only. Returns a reference to the most recently sent value. Outstanding borrows hold a read lock. This means that long lived borrows could … Webb15 juni 2024 · Now, a team of scientists from Tokyo Institute of Technology (Tokyo Tech), led by Associate Professor Atsushi Shirane, have reported the production of a wirelessly powered transmitter-receiver for 5G networks that overcomes both of these problems. Their findings were presented during the 2024 IEEE Symposium on VLSI Technology & …

Webbkafka集成指南. Apache kafka是一个分布式的发布-订阅消息系统,它可以分布式的、可分区的、可重复提交的方式读写日志数据。下面我们将具体介绍Spark Streaming怎样从kafka中 接收数据。. 关联:在你的SBT或者Maven项目定义中,引用下面的组件到流应用程序中。

Webbpub struct Receiver { /* fields omitted */ } Expand description. Receiving end of an Unix pipe. See new for documentation, including examples. Implementations. impl Receiver. pub fn set_nonblocking(&self, nonblocking: bool) -> Result< > Set the Receiver into or out of non-blocking mode. Trait Implementations henry\u0027s online canadaWebbWe pass the original transmitter to a second spawned thread. This gives us two threads, each sending different messages to the one receiver. When you run the code, your output should look something like this: Got: hi Got: more Got: from Got: messages Got: for Got: the Got: thread Got: you. henry\u0027s on clay dunmorehenry\u0027s on devine street in columbia scWebb当在 Tokio 中生成( spawan )任务时,其 async 语句块必须拥有其中数据的所有权。而 select! 并没有这个限制,它的每个分支表达式可以直接借用数据,然后进行并发操作。 henry\u0027s on clay menuWebbReceives the next value for this receiver. This method returns None if the channel has been closed and there are no remaining messages in the channel’s buffer. This indicates that no further values can ever be received from this Receiver.The channel is closed when all senders have been dropped, or when close is called.. If there are no messages in the … henry\u0027s on clay scranton paWebbTokio的主要目标是让用户部署可预测的软件,使其每天都有相同的表现,有可靠的响应时间,没有不可预知的延迟峰值。 简单 有了Rust的 async/await 功能,编写异步应用程序 … henry\u0027s on clay bakeryWebbAPI documentation for the Rust `Receiver` struct in crate `tokio`. Docs.rs. tokio-0.1.18. tokio 0.1.18 ... This prevents any further messages from being sent on the channel while … henry\\u0027s on the market